Job Description

SOFTSWISS is seeking an experienced Security Analyst to join its expanding team. This role involves conducting security audits, assessing new and existing tools for risks, and collaborating with stakeholders to define security requirements. The analyst will also be responsible for developing and maintaining corporate security policies and enhancing governance processes to ensure compliance and strengthen overall security measures within the organization.

Overview:

SOFTSWISS continues to expand the team and is looking for a Security analyst. We need a true, experienced, and accomplished professional who shares our culture and values.

Key responsibilities:

  • Conduct security audits on systems to identify risks, address vulnerabilities, and strengthen security measures
  • Perform security assessments for new and existing tools, services, and integrations, identifying potential risks and providing clear requirements and recommendations
  • Collaborate with business and technical owners to define the intended purpose of a tool, the data it stores, and its associated security risks
  • Review access requirements as part of tool and integration security assessments, ensuring permissions are granted on a need‑to‑know basis
  • Develop and maintain corporate security policies and guidelines related to software and technology usage
  • Support and enhance governance processes to ensure security and compliance.

Requirements:

  • 5+ years of experience in cybersecurity, preferably within GRC Security
  • Proven experience conducting security assessments for third-party tools and integrations
  • Strong understanding of technology governance processes, access control principles, and risk assessment methodologies
  • Ability to collaborate effectively with multiple business stakeholders and translate technical risks into business context
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ills in English (Upper-Intermediate or above).

Nice to have:

  • Familiarity with AI governance and security considerations
  • Knowledge of governance frameworks (e.g., ISO 27001, NIST) and relevant compliance obligations.
